Expertise of the Industry

Inhaling asbestos fibers in the air can cause many ailments and diseases. Mesothelioma is the most hazardous and most fatal form of asbestos exposure. However, other asbestos-related diseases are also present. These include the pleural disease (fibrosis of the lungs which can cause shortness of breath) and lung cancer. Asbestos exposure can also increase your risk of developing cancers in the stomach and larynx.

Knowledge of the Statute of Limitations

Asbestos victims have a limited time frame to bring a lawsuit. It is important for the victim to locate mesothelioma lawyers who understand the time limit for filing a lawsuit. This will ensure that the victim can pursue their case without being hindered by the absence of deadlines.

For most personal injury cases the statute of limitations kicks in when an individual is injured. However when it comes to asbestos exposure, there is a special rule referred to as the discovery rule. The statute of limitations is in effect when the asbestos-related disease has been identified, and not when the person first came into contact with asbestos. This is because mesothelioma as well as other asbestos-related illnesses typically have a long latency period.

The discovery rule is vital for victims as it allows them to bring a mesothelioma lawsuit against the companies that wrongfully exposed them to asbestos. A mesothelioma suit is filed as a personal injury lawsuit and includes monetary compensation, including for income loss medical expenses, loss of income, as well as suffering and pain. The family members of a victim that died from mesothelioma, or a different asbestos-related disease, can also file a wrongful death lawsuit. In wrongful-death suits, juries award compensation to the victims and their family members for funeral expenses and loss of companionship. Asbestos victims may also be able to file a workers compensation claim against their employer to receive financial aid. Veterans' benefits may be available for those who served in the military. Workers' compensation claims are generally resolved out of court while mesothelioma lawsuits often go to trial.
